For the educational program for hospitalized children, titled: "museum on wheels" project to transport basic exhibits and educational materials - displayed at the museum - to hospitalized children at the Children´s Hospital "Agia Sophia" who cannot physically visit the museum and for a program for children in Lavrio, a low income area 70 kms southeast of Athens.The Hellenic Children’s Museum was founded in 1987 in Athens by a group of young scientists. It is designed to help children develop their potential to become socially aware citizens. The museum organizes a variety of educational, interdisciplinary programs for both children and adults.  The programs’ main goals are to familiarize children with art, the museum, and the cultural and technological heritage of Greece.
